14 December 1910 | Caithness | Independent Conservative | 87 | 3.10 | |
Archibald Macleod, described as a traveller residing in Liverpool, was nominated by members of Thurso Unionist Club. He was immediately disowned by the Conservative and Liberal Unionist organisations and did not appear in the constituency throughout the campaign. It was alleged by the local (Liberal) press that his nomination was merely to deprive Robert Harmsworth of an unopposed return and cause the Liberal Association the inconvenience and expense of a contested election. |
